Guide to Picking the Right Exterior Doors and Windows for Your Home

When it comes to producing a welcoming, practical, and energy-efficient home, the importance of exterior windows and doors can not be overemphasized. They serve as the gateways to your house, using security, insulation, natural light, and visual appeal. Whether you're building a new home, renovating an existing one, or simply trying to find an upgrade, choosing the best exterior doors and windows is an important decision. This article will assist you through the essential factors to think about when picking these necessary elements.

1. Comprehend the Role of Exterior Doors and Windows
Exterior upvc windows doors and doors are more than simply entry points or frames to display views. They play numerous roles, including:

Energy Efficiency: High-quality windows and doors uk and doors assist control the interior temperature level by preventing heat loss in the winter season and heat gain in the summertime.
Security: They secure your home from trespassers and extreme weather.
Natural Light and Ventilation: Windows enable sunlight to filter into your space, developing a brighter environment, while likewise offering fresh air when opened.
Suppress Appeal: Doors and windows significantly add to the first impression your home makes on visitors and passersby.
With these functions in mind, it's clear that cautious factor to consider is essential to make the best option.

2. Types of Exterior Doors
Exterior doors are available in various styles, materials, and setups to match your requirements and personal style. Here are the most typical types:

a. Front Entry upvc doors and windows
The front door is typically the centerpiece of a home's exterior. Long lasting products such as steel, fiberglass, or strong wood work well for entry doors as they use high security and visual appeal. Think about adding ornamental components like glass panels or sidelights to boost beauty without jeopardizing privacy.

Sliding glass doors, French doors, and bi-fold doors are popular alternatives for outdoor patio gain access to. Each adds functionality while providing expansive outside views. For homes with smaller spaces, sliding doors are an exceptional choice, while French doors include a classic, classic appearance.

c. Storm and Screen Doors
Storm and screen doors are secondary doors set up in front of your primary exterior door. They provide an additional layer of defense versus weather condition and aid with ventilation during mild climate condition without permitting insects to get in.

3. Kinds Of Exterior Windows
Like doors, exterior windows been available in various designs to match different requirements and architectural styles. The most typical types consist of:

a. Double-Hung Windows
These standard windows, which feature 2 sashes that slide up and down, are flexible and work for almost any home design. They offer exceptional ventilation and are easy to tidy.

b. Casement Windows
Depended upon one side and operated by a crank, casement windows open external for optimum ventilation. They're an ideal choice for locations where wind pressure might be an issue, as their seal is generally tighter.

c. Picture Windows
Picture windows are big, set panes of glass that do not open, using continuous views of the outdoors. They're best for spaces where natural light and expansive views are desired.

d. Awning and Hopper Windows
Awning windows open external from the bottom, while hopper windows open inward from the top. Both styles are fantastic for maintaining personal privacy while permitting ventilation, typically used in restrooms or basements.

e. Bay and Bow Windows
Bay and bow windows extend external, producing a relaxing nook inside and including beauty and measurement to your home's exterior.

4. Elements to Consider When Choosing Exterior Doors and aluminium windows doors
a. Material
The product you choose effects the sturdiness, energy efficiency, and visual appeal of your doors and windows. Common choices consist of:

Wood: Elegant and traditional but might need more maintenance.
Vinyl: Affordable and low-maintenance with good energy efficiency.
Fiberglass: Extremely long lasting, weather-resistant, Exterior Doors and Windows and energy-efficient.
Aluminum: Sleek and contemporary but less insulating.
Steel: Offers remarkable security and toughness.
b. Energy Efficiency
Try to find energy-efficient products, preferably with ENERGY STAR certifications. Aspects like double- or triple-glazing, Low-E finishes, and insulated frames can considerably lower energy expenses and enhance comfort.

c. Security Features
Doors need to be built with strong materials and equipped with dependable locks like deadbolts. Windows must consist of features like tempered glass, camera locks, and impact-resistant options to boost security.

d. Style and Aesthetic
Your home's style will affect your options. For a modern home, choose smooth, minimalist styles. For traditional or farmhouse designs, think about standard or rustic alternatives.

e. Weather Resistance
Homes in areas vulnerable to extreme weather ought to focus on weather-resistant materials. Storm windows and doors with impact-resistant glass are important in hurricane-prone areas.

f. Installation and Maintenance
Correct installation is critical for both functionality and durability. Expert installation guarantees a tight seal to avoid air and water seepage. Furthermore, consider long-term maintenance requirements when choosing materials.

5. Benefits of Upgrading Exterior Doors and Windows
If your existing doors and windows are obsoleted, updating them can offer a number of benefits:

Increased Property Value: New, premium doors and windows improve curb appeal and home resale worth.
Improved Energy Efficiency: Modern items lower energy costs by keeping indoor temperature.
Better Security: Upgraded materials and locking systems keep your home safe.
Improved Comfort: Eliminate drafts or excess sound with insulated, well-sealed items.
